reasonable care in examining documents

Definition

Bank's duty to examine all documents (presented under a documentary credit arrangement) with due care to establish their apparent (prima facie) compliance with the terms and conditions of the credit, and consistency in relation to one another. However, it is not the bank's duty to verify their accuracy, form, falsification or genuineness, or legal effect or sufficiency. And the bank is not liable or responsible for the condition, delivery, description, existence, packing, quality, quantity, value, or weight of the goods represented by such documents.
